Page 81 - Matematik Zenginleştirilmiş Öğretim Etkinlikleri 10
P. 81
ORTAÖĞRETİM KADEMESİNDE FARKLILAŞTIRILMIŞ ÖĞRETİM UYGULAMALARI ~ ZENGİNLEŞTİRİLMİŞ ÖĞRETİM ETKİNLİKLERİ
MATEMATİK
10. SINIF
Öğretmen, “Mars Lojistik Merkezi’nden az önce kırmızı kodlu bir yardım çağrısı aldık! Kızıl
Gezegen’deki kolonilerimize hayati önem taşıyan gıda, oksijen ve yakıt taşıyan insansız
robot filomuz büyük bir karmaşa içinde. Her robotun kendine has bir işleme kapasitesi
(2, 3, 4, 5, 8, 9 ve 10 birimlik bölmeler) var. Ancak ana bilgisayardaki bir yazılım hatası
nedeniyle, gönderilen devasa veri paketleri (çok basamaklı barkod numaraları) robotların
kapasitesine uyum sağlamıyor. Sistemimiz şu an kalan veri uyarısı veriyor. Eğer bir barkod
numarası robotun kapasitesine tam bölünmüyorsa, ortaya çıkan artık birimler sistemde
enerji dengesizliğine yol açıyor ve lojistik akışı durduruyor. Sizden beklenen bu devasa veri
setlerini hızlıca analiz ederek, hangi kargonun hangi robotla Sıfır Atık (Kalan = 0) prensibiyle
taşınabileceğini bulmanız. Eğer bir uyumsuzluk varsa, bu artıkları nasıl birleştirip sistemi
kurtaracağımıza dair stratejik kararlar vermeniz gerekiyor. Mars kolonilerinin kaderi, sizin
bölünebilme kurallarını ne kadar hızlı ve hatasız kullandığınıza bağlı!” (ÜFGHP1, IFS1,
SFÜDD1).
Grup görevlerine geçmeden hemen önce öğretmen Mars Lojistik Yazılımının çalışma
prensibini tahtaya yansıtır.
Öğretmen robotik kodun çalışma mantığını açıklar: “Robot bir kargo barkodunu okuduğunda
içindeki sayısal veriyi alır. Robot, bu kodu kendi hafızasındaki kapasite sayısına böler. Eğer
kod, robotun kapasitesine tam bölünüyor yani kalan sıfır oluyorsa sistem bu kodun geçerli
ve güvenli olduğunu onaylar. Robot kargoyu yakalar ve doğru depoya taşır. Eğer bölme
işlemi sonucunda bir kalan oluşursa, bu artık veri sistemin işleyişine sığmadığı için robot,
kargonun içindeki sayısal yükün kapasiteye tam uyan kısmını onaylar; artan (bölünemeyen)
sayısal değeri ise bir uyumsuzluk birimi olarak geri kazanım deposuna aktarır. Sistem,
depodaki bu farklı artıkları birleştirerek yeni bir tam paket oluşturmaya çalışır veya kalanı
tam taşıyabilecek daha küçük bir robota transfer eder (SFAU1).
Uygulama Aşamaları
Robotların kullandığı kısa yol stratejileri (bölünebilme kuralları) şu şekildedir:
Hız Robotları (2, 5, 10): Sadece son birime (birler basamağına) odaklanır.
Toplam Robotları (3, 9): Tüm kodun enerji toplamına (rakamlar toplamı) bakar.
Hassas Robotlar (4, 8): Kodun son iki veya üç hanesindeki sayısal değerlere odaklanır.
Robotik kodların mantığını kavrayan öğrenciler, bu kuralları kullanarak lojistik krizini çözmek
için öğrenciler ilgi alanlarına göre üç farklı Lojistik Uzmanlık Grubuna ayrılır. Öğrencilere
kendi çalışma yollarını ve analiz yöntemlerini seçme özgürlüğü tanınır (SFGE1, SFSÖ1).
Öğrenciler, ilgi alanlarına göre seçtikleri uzmanlık masalarına geçerler. Her grup, önündeki
Mars Veri Panelindeki karmaşık sayı dizilerini kendi stratejileriyle analiz eder.
A Grubu (Veri Analistleri): Ellerindeki devasa veri setlerini yukarıdaki kısa yol protokollerine
göre hızlıca filtreler. Kargo kodundaki bir basamak silindiğinde (ör. 82X41 sayısının 3
ile tam bölünebilmesi durumu), sistemin çökmemesi için X yerine gelebilecek değerleri
hesaplayarak önleyici bakım yaparlar (IFS2).
B Grubu (Sistem Tasarımcıları): Reddedilen kargo miktarlarını (kalanları) hesaplayarak
bu veri yüklerinin başka hangi kapasitedeki robotlarla kurtarılabileceğini belirleyerek kalan
veri yüklerinin matematiğini yapar. Kalanların toplanabilirliği ilkesini kullanarak iki farklı
kargo kodundan artan değerleri birleştirilip yeni bir tam paket oluşturup oluşturamayacağını
analiz ederler. Eğer 9 luk robotta 4 birim artıyorsa, bu veri yüklerin başka hangi robot
kombinasyonuyla (ör. 2 lik robotlar) sıfır atığa dönüştürüleceğini hesaplar (SFAY1).
C Grubu (Algoritma Denetçileri): Bölünebilme kurallarının nasıl çalıştığını ispatlayarak
sistemi optimize eder (ör. 9 ile bölünebilmede basamak değerlerinin toplamının mantığı)
Yazılımın neden 9 için rakamları toplamı kuralını kullandığını, basamak değerlerini
(100a + 10b + c) kullanarak ispatlar (IFK1).
ZENGİNLEŞTİRİLMİŞ ÖĞRETİM ETKİNLİKLERİ 83

